Struct aws_sdk_cloudfront::types::error::TooManyRealtimeLogConfigs
source · #[non_exhaustive]pub struct TooManyRealtimeLogConfigs {
pub message: Option<String>,
/* private fields */
}
Expand description
You have reached the maximum number of real-time log configurations for this Amazon Web Services account. For more information, see Quotas (formerly known as limits) in the Amazon CloudFront Developer Guide.
